Context: the quote-generation endpoints on Thistledown run infrequently, so customers occasionally hit 4–6 second first-request latency. We've enabled pre-warmed instances for the three worst handlers and added a cold-start tag to traces, so you can confirm quickly whether a slow report is cold-start related. If latency complaints persist beyond next Tuesday's rollout, don't debug locally — escalate directly. Ongoing ownership of this workstream sits with the engineer named below.

account owner for bawip-tahag: Raleth Quenok

Runbook fragment — ThumbForge image cache memory leak

New folks: the ThumbForge render nodes occasionally leak memory in the decoded-image cache when eviction stalls under burst load. Symptoms are steadily climbing RSS on one or two nodes and slower thumbnail responses. Short-term fix is a rolling restart of the affected pods — never restart all at once, or the cache rebuild will hammer the origin store. Capture a heap snapshot first if you can. The step-by-step mitigation guide is on the internal page here:

runbook for tafof-yawif: https://confluence.tolvaqsys.internal/display/display/browse/pages/7be3

**Break-glass: Ladlewise recipe-scaling calculator**

The Ladlewise calculator's conversion tables are served from a sealed config vault. If scaling output goes wrong in production (e.g., the Pinchfork incident, where yields doubled), break-glass access lets you hot-patch the ratio tables without a full deploy. Use only after confirming the fault with two sample recipes. Record the action in the release log before and after. To unseal the vault, enter the recovery passphrase given directly below.

strongbox words: praath-queniel-holax-druael-jorath-noveth-druok

**Q: Why does the Fairnight parity checker skip weekend rates?** Short version: the upstream feed from Quillhaven batches weekends into Monday's pull, so comparing early gives false mismatches. Your review of PR 412 should check that the skip window is configurable, not hardcoded. To run the integration suite locally, unlock the test fixtures vault with the passphrase below.

vault phrase of yagag-yafof = belael-weniel-kasion-silath-jorax-pelox-silir-soreth-ralmir